Transaction 77279a6107eefb7db4b15a027d6655c09b0c610366707dc4b2ffef71c4e162e2

1 Input
2 Outputs
  • 77279a6107eefb7db4b15a027d6655c09b0c610366707dc4b2ffef71c4e162e2:0
  • value  1200000
    address  33WiNFQRhBDHRLajyQk4czHwko4aV3NKKL
  • 77279a6107eefb7db4b15a027d6655c09b0c610366707dc4b2ffef71c4e162e2:1
  • value  1392339949
    address  bc1q28v7a5jykqxzqvu5zlq5r5yevwrteaxtdsypgd